George Mayer is back with Mike Shani as the pair revisit Mike’s collection to look at the impressive watches he’s added to his watch box. Independent watchmakers on display are from greats of the past like Philippe Dufour’s Simplicity and George Daniels’s Millennium to the next generation such as Keaton Myrick and Rexhep Rexhepi with the Akrivia AK-06. Finally, the pair discuss what they consider the ultimate display of independent craftmanship: the Greubel Forsey Hand Made 1
